Berchtesgaden

Berchtesgaden was Hitler's retreat in the Bavarian Alps. Apart from his house there, the Berghof, he had high up above it the ‘Eagle's Nest’, a small house amidst panoramic views. The Berghof and its surrounding buildings were razed to the ground after the war, but the ‘Eagle's Nest’ can still be visited.

Berchtesgaden

Berchtesgaden , town (1994 pop. 8,050), Bavaria, SE Germany, in the Bavarian Alps. It is a popular winter and summer resort. Salt has been mined there since the 12th cent. At the nearby Obersalzberg is the site of Hitler's residence, the Berghof.

Berchtesgaden

Berchtesgaden, Bavaria/Germany ‘Perhtger's House’ from the personal name and the Old High German gadum or gaden ‘one‐roomed house’.

Berchtesgaden

Berchtesgaden a town in southern Germany in the Bavarian alps, site of Hitler's fortified retreat.
